Abstract

A sine-cosine squared-magnitude function for a digital bandpass filter is proposed. It offers a maximally flat pass-band magnitude response and more flexibility on the number of exchangeable zeros at ωT = 0 and ωT = π rad. © 1979, The Institution of Electrical Engineers. All rights reserved.
